Aldar Properties said today that its projects in Abu Dhabi are progressing on schedule.

“Al Hadeel, Ansam, Al Merief, Nareel Island residential projects are all on track to be completed according to their respective schedules with steady progress being made on foundational, structural and MEP work," it said in a statement.

It added that work is progressing across all aspects of the West Yas development, Aldar’s first villa community on Yas Island, including all precincts, marine, electrical, lighting and telecommunications work.

The construction of the Aldar Academies’ operated school on Yas Island is “nearing completion" and it will be operational for the beginning of the 2016–2017 academic year.

Shams Meera on Reem Island, Aldar’s first mid-market project, has enabling teams on site for the shoring, piling, and excavation of the three level basement. The tendering for the main contract is expected to be awarded during this quarter, Aldar said.

Infrastructure development at Shams Abu Dhabi on Reem Island has seen the South Canal opened, while during the previous quarter Aldar awarded contracts for the closed canal and pre-concept designs were submitted for the central park. Furthermore, Aldar said “the east sandy beach has now been completed along with the Repton School area".

At Al Raha Beach, Aldar said that following the completion of the phase one Al Dana infrastructure, substantial works were completed on the second phase, which includes landscaping and road embankment, sewer works, dredging works, storm water networks and district cooling.
